Matt Broman was stellar on the mound as Rochester John Marshall pulled out a 10-inning 1-0 Big Nine Conference baseball win over Owatonna on Friday in Big Nine Conference action.
Broman allowed no hits and no runs, as he pitched the first nine innings. He walked three and struck out eight. Gavin Sandwick got the win, tossing the final frame. He permitted one hit, and struck out two.
"Matt Broman was exceptional today, throwing nine innings of no-hit baseball," JM coach Terry Heiderscheit said.
In the bottom if the 10th inning, Alex Brady hit a walk-off single, scoring Jack Kall from third base.
"Brady squared one up hard to left field," Heiderscheit said. "It was a fun game to be a part of."
